I could embed/rework the script to contain also the column -t command but I did not saw the need to – but its of course possible. Why hardcode this? For comparison purposes – more on that later. The length of ‘=’ underscores is defined/hardcoded in the scripts itself. Herbert-pierre-hugues 555123456 - executive Here is how the above VCARD information looks after converting it with my script to the plain text columns. I do not find this VCARD format readable, nor grepable/searchable, thus I convert it into the plain text file which looks like follows and is grep(1) and awk(1) friendly (columns separated by spaces). The 'gg:' is for example for the Polish solution called Gadu-Gadu. I keep this Instant Messaging number/account information in the VCARD 'X-QQ' field in which I use protocol:number notation and use it for all different Instant Messaging solutions. Now several years fast forward I use it very rarely, but its still in use. In 2015 when I initially wrote those scripts the Instant Messaging was still used by me. The VCARD of course starts with 'BEGIN:VCARD' and ends with 'END:VCARD', that is obvious. The remaining fields as 'TEL' or 'EMAIL' does not try to outsmart us and work as desired. The 'FN' field is a lot more useful here. The most annoying field seems to be 'N' which tries to be smarter then needed – trying really hard to first put surname, then name, and then other names. I have used colors to distinguish different contacts. The VCF file (also called VCARD) exported from a mobile Android based phone looks like below. So as usual I came with my set of scripts that will do the job and after several years of using this ‘system’ I am quite satisfied with the results and PITA reduced to minimum. I have tried to search for some open source software that is capable of doing that efficiently and without too much effort and PITA … and I failed miserably. But that was not the answer – that was just the beginning – how to manage contacts the UNIX open source way? Finally he settled on some closed source freeware software which run on Windows. He had a problem of having an iPhone with iTunes and Android phone and wanted to manage contacts between them in one single sensible place. No scripting required!Ĭompatibility: Intel, 64-bit processor OS X 10.About two years ago my neighbor asked me a question – “How do you manage contacts on your devices?” – and that was my ‘a-ha’ moment in that topic – I do not. Simply add a server, and see discovered devices.ĪutoMounter is sandboxed, uses native MacOS frameworks, and doesn’t store your credentials. You can also tie your server to a WiFi access point SSID.ĭiscovers available servers that provides filesharing services. Send a Wake-On-LAN packet on network change. No annoying notifications, it’s all visible in the menu bar, one click away.Īdd multiple devices that provide network shares, and AutoMounter will keep track of them all. Whenever you change locations, AutoMounter will mount your shares from the available server, and they will appear on your Desktop.ĭetects when you’ve changed networks, and will automatically attempt to mount shares from any available server.ĪutoMounter stays out of your way. If you’ve got a NAS appliance, a server at work, or even shared folders on your other computers, you’ll know how time consuming it is to keep them mounted.ĪutoMounter makes this easy by ensuring your shares are always available. We wanted our network shares always accessible and ready to use. AutoMounter is a sleek and powerful menu item for automatically mounting your network shares.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|